Stay Prepared

While ⁣it’s impossible‌ to predict​ every last-minute opportunity,​ there‍ are certain steps ‌you ⁣can take to stay prepared. Consider these tips:

  • Always keep your bag packed: Having a well-organized model bag ⁤with‍ essentials like⁣ makeup,‍ hairbrush, and versatile ⁣wardrobe ⁣items ensures ​you’re⁤ ready to go at ⁤a⁣ moment’s notice.
  • Maintain excellent physical ⁣shape: ⁣ Regular‌ exercise​ and a healthy diet ​help ensure you’re confident and ready to work, regardless​ of the time frame.
  • Stay updated on industry news and trends: ⁤ Being knowledgeable⁢ about the⁤ industry and‌ aware of any upcoming events or shifts helps⁣ you ⁤anticipate potential⁤ last-minute ​opportunities.

Quick Communication

The key ‍to ⁢successfully⁤ navigating ⁣last-minute​ bookings⁤ lies within quick and effective⁣ communication. When ⁤you receive a⁤ sudden offer,‌ respond promptly and professionally. Confirm your‌ availability, discuss⁤ compensation,​ and⁢ gather ⁢all⁤ the necessary‌ details to help ⁢prepare ⁢yourself ⁤accordingly. ⁣If⁣ you have ⁣any ​concerns or​ hesitations, always⁢ communicate them openly ⁢and honestly.

Maintain Your Professionalism

It’s ⁢no ‍secret that last-minute bookings can be hectic‍ and stressful, but the⁤ true mark of a professional model lies ⁣in their ability⁢ to maintain composure and professionalism under pressure.‌ Even if you’re feeling overwhelmed, remember to:

  • Be punctual: ⁤ Arriving on time, or even a ‍little ​early, shows respect for the client’s time and​ helps build your reputation as a reliable model.
  • Be adaptable: Prepare yourself mentally for potential ⁢changes⁣ in concept, location, or wardrobe. Embrace the⁢ challenges ‌and showcase your ⁤versatility.
  • Be positive: ​Approach every last-minute booking ⁢with a positive mindset. ⁢Your attitude can significantly ⁣impact the ​outcome ​of ​the shoot and​ your​ working relationships.
